More About "metalworker crossword clue"
The term "metalworker" encompasses a vast range of skilled individuals who transform raw metal into finished products. From ancient times, working with metal has been crucial for human development, leading to advancements in tools, weapons, art, and infrastructure. Different types of metalworkers specialize in specific metals or techniques, such as forging, welding, casting, or machining.
A blacksmith, for instance, traditionally works with iron, shaping it through heat and hammering, often creating decorative gates, railings, or tools. A welder focuses on joining metal pieces using various processes like arc welding or gas welding, essential for construction and manufacturing. A tinsmith specializes in working with tin plate, often making lighter household items or repairing them. Understanding these distinctions can sometimes help narrow down the correct crossword answer.
